SHREVEPORT, La. — As the holiday season approaches, Christian Service is hosting its annual Poor Man’s Supper to help feed families in need across Shreveport. The event will take place this Sunday, continuing a long-standing tradition of community support and outreach.

KTBS 3 spoke with Al Moore, Executive Director of the Christian Service Program of Shreveport, who emphasized the importance of the supper, which offers a simple meal with a powerful message of hope and togetherness.

The supper brings together volunteers, local residents, and community leaders to prepare and serve meals, while also raising awareness about food insecurity in the area. Christian Service encourages attendees to participate through volunteering, donations, or simply attending the meal.
